Understanding Adaptive Cruise Control Systems
Adaptive Cruise Control (ACC) is a crucial feature in many luxury sedans today, significantly enhancing safety features. ACC systems automatically adjust a vehicle’s speed to maintain a safe distance from the vehicle ahead. This is particularly beneficial for handling motorway driving and heavy traffic conditions in the UK.
Key components of adaptive cruise control include radars, cameras, and sensors. These instruments work together to detect and monitor the speed and distance of the car in front. By doing so, they play a pivotal role in ensuring safety and improving performance, providing a smooth driving experience even in busy traffic.
